Understanding Your Washing Appliance
Washing home appliances are elaborate equipments, designed with a variety of setups to efficiently tidy and look after various material types. The fundamental makeup of these devices consists of a drum for holding clothes, an agitator or impeller to assist displace dust, a water pump for washing, and an electric motor for spinning and drying. Understanding these fundamental elements and their features can significantly boost the operation and long life of your laundry home appliance.

Laundry home appliances come geared up with a range of advanced sensors and control board that regulate their procedure. These features are developed to enhance the washing process by adjusting variables such as load size, water temperature, and cycle length. It's vital to recognize the function and function of these controls to obtain one of the most out of your appliance and to troubleshoot any kind of problems that may emerge. By having this understanding, users can diagnose and fix problems successfully, saving them money and time that would certainly be invested in expert repairs.

Taking care of Issues of Water Loading
The typical source of water loading concerns in laundry machines is often connected to a breakdown in the water inlet valve or the stress switch. The shutoff controls the water flow right into the appliance, and the stress button signals when the wanted water level is reached. When the shutoff is defective or the stress switch is not functioning properly, it can result in imprecise water levels, causing either way too much or inadequate water to fill the equipment.

One technique of repairing includes by hand filling the maker with water. If the machine runs usually when manually filled up, the issue most likely lies within the water inlet shutoff. Alternatively, if an excessive amount of water gets in the machine in spite of getting to the set degree, the pressure button is likely the wrongdoer. It is important for house owners to follow the particular instructions and security preventative measures provided by the producer when checking these parts, or take into consideration employing the help of a specialist.

Attending To Water Drainage Issues
When a laundry maker experiences water drainage problems, one usual sign is water sticking around inside the home appliance also after a clean cycle ends. This problem can be triggered by various variables such as a blocked or kinked drainpipe tube, or a malfunctioning drainpipe pump. Being aware of these normal causes is critical for recognizing and fixing the underlying concern effectively. If water remains to accumulate regardless of several rinse attempts, it is vital to act immediately to stop water damage or the development of mold and mildew.

Adopting Laundry Aplliance Repair an organized technique to address water drainage interruptions can yield sufficient results. Firstly, an aesthetic inspection of the drain pipe can reveal possible obstructions or physical damages. If clearing the obstruction or correcting a curved pipe does not provide a resolution, it could be time to think about a faulty drain pump, which might need specialist servicing or substitute. Additionally, mindfully checking any type of mistake code that appears on the device's console during the cycle can give important understandings regarding the nature of the disturbance. A device manual can help in translating these error messages, better helping in determining the exact problem.

Repairing Problems with Drum Turning
Encountering a drum that will not spin is a regular problem that can occur with your cleaning equipment. This concern commonly suggests a mechanical issue, typically related to the electric motor, belts, or cover button. The electric motor is in charge of driving the spinning activity in your washing machine, so if it's damaged or defective, the drum will not revolve. Furthermore, useless belts or cover switches can also restrain the drum's activity.

Determining the origin of a non-spinning problem can be a difficult task, however it's a vital action in fixing the trouble effectively. To begin, examine the cover switch for any kind of signs of damages or wear. You can quickly validate if the cover switch is the perpetrator by listening for a distinctive clicking sound when opening up and closing the cover. If the sound is missing, changing the lid button may be essential. Sometimes, broken belts or worn out motors might call for a more thorough inspection by an expert. Bear in mind, security needs to always be your top concern when working with electrical or mechanical parts, so make sure the washer is unplugged prior to examining any kind of components.

Resolving Laundry Cycle Disruptions
Laundry appliance issues can prolong past plain water loading or draining pipes problems. Insufficient cycles, where the machine stops suddenly during laundry, rinse, or spin cycles, can be particularly vexing. This problem can stem from various sources, including malfunctioning timers or control panel, malfunctioning cover buttons, overheating motors, or defective water level switches. Dealing with these underlying causes is essential to recovering the device's regular cycle.

To resolve this problem, it is essential to very carefully diagnose the problem and determine its underlying cause. Begin by taking a look at the lid button to see if it is worn out and no more functioning effectively. Next, examine the water level switch for any type of defects that can result in wrong signals being sent to the maker. It is also vital to inspect the control panel and timer of the appliance as any type of mistakes in these parts might cause the device quiting mid-cycle or failing to begin. It is important to come close to repairing with care as a result of the involvement of electrical energy, and if you are unsure regarding any kind of step, it is best to seek help from a certified expert.

Handling Excessive Sound and Vibration Issues
If your washing machine is creating too much noise and resonance, maybe an indicator of various problems such as an unbalanced lots or a faulty component in the appliance. Vibrations frequently occur when clothes are not equally expanded in the drum, yet this can be dealt with by stopping the cycle and rearranging the load. However, if the sound and resonance proceed, it might be brought on by worn-out or loosened drive belts, drum bearings, or electric motor elements.

To identify precisely, an individual may need to manually check the mentioned components for any kind of indicators of wear or damages and replace any type of malfunctioning elements promptly. If your device is consistently making loud noises, regardless of your efforts at tons redistribution, it's strongly recommended to consult a specialist. A professional professional will certainly have the skills and understanding to identify and fix the origin of the issue, ensuring your device operates smoothly and silently. It's important to deal with these issues without delay, as long term vibrations or noises might trigger further damages to your home appliance or surroundings.

Fixing Temperature Law Problems
On several circumstances, wrong temperature level regulation in cleaning equipments can trigger substantial inconvenience. This problem primarily happens when the thermostat or the burner of your device encounters technological faults. The thermostat is in charge of controlling the water temperature level while the burner guarantees the water is appropriately heated up for every clean cycle. However, a single problem in functioning, whether because of deterioration, damaged wiring, or an unresponsive control panel, can wet the effective operation of your home appliance.

To address this, it's important to start with fundamental troubleshooting. Begin with evaluating the washing device's temperature setting. It needs to represent the treatment tags on your laundry-- too expensive or as well low a temperature can damage fabrics and influence the total cleaning effectiveness. If the setups are in order but the temperature appears wrong, specialist help might be needed. Trained specialists can carry out the necessary inspections of the heating element and thermostat, execute requisite fixings, or recommend replacement parts as needed. It's very suggested not to attempt any inner fixings without expert supervision as it might bring about unsafe circumstances and likewise void any kind of existing service warranties.
